Abstract

Ubiquitous computing environment must provide users with seamless anytime and anywhere access to services. However, the ubiquitous computing environment contains many weaknesses in security, and creates many problems for user's anonymity and privacy. Therefore, we proposed a novel ticket-based AAA(Authentication, Authorization, Accounting) mechanism for ubiquitous environment. The AAA mechanism is information security technology that systematically provides authentication, authorization and accounting functions, not only in the existing wire network but also in the rapidly developing ubiquitous network, with various ubiquitous services and protocol. Currently, IETF(Internet Engineering Task Force) AAA Working Group deals with about secure AAA protocol in ubiquitous network and studies methods that offer secure authentication through mobility of Mobile Nodes. Therefore, in this paper, the AAAH(Home Authentication Server) authenticates the Mobile device. After that, it uses a ticket issued from AAAH, even if the device moves to a foreign network, and can provide service in foreign network without accessing by AAAH. We also present a mechanism that can offer user privacy and anonymity. This proposed mechanism can reduce the signal and reduce the delay of message exchanged using tickets, can offer persistent service and heightened security and efficiency.
